Rachael Read 1735–1813 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 29 Jan 1735

Birth Location: Maddington, Wiltshire, England

Death Date: 28 Jan 1813

Death Location: Shrewton, Wiltshire Unitary Authority, Wiltshire, England

Father: John Read

Mother: Martha Best

Spouse(s): William Blake

Children(s): Ann Blake, Francis Blake, Thomas BLAKE, Leah BLAKE, William BLAKE, Mary BLAKE

Rachael Read was born in 1735 in Maddington, Wiltshire, England, the child of John Read And Martha Best. Rachael Read married William Blake, and had children including Ann Blake, Francis Blake, Leah Blake, Mary Blake, Thomas Blake, William Blake. Rachael Read passed away in 1813 in Shrewton, Wiltshire Unitary Authority, Wiltshire, England.
